Western state legislators coming to Hawaii for annual meeting

Lawmakers from 13 Western states are traveling to Hawaii next week for the Council of State Governments-WEST’s annual meeting.

More than 500 people are expected to attend the meeting at the Sheraton Waikiki from July 30 to Aug. 2.

The Council of State Governments-WEST is a nonpartisan organization that provides a forum for legislators to share ideas and network with other elected political leaders from the region.

Speakers at the conference include CNN’s Candy Crowley, Pacific Fleet Commander Admiral Patrick Walsh and Futurist Joel Kotkin.

Hawaii lawmakers will discuss foreclosure legislation, economic development, health, invasive species and women in politics.

Hawaii House Finance Committee Chairman Marcus Oshiro is the chair of the council’s meeting. House Speaker Calvin Say, Senate President Shan Tsutsui and Sen. Brian Taniguchi are co-hosts.
